'Show Me'

THE MAIL

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

To the Editors of The Crimson:

As a native of St. Louis, Missouri, I was shocked and dismayed upon my arrival in Cambridge three years ago at the incredible chauvinism and parochialism of Easterners. You pride yourselves on your amazing intellectual prowess, yet you have displayed a lack of knowledge of fourth-grade geography. In your article concerning election results you state that Carter won "without winning a single state west of the Mississippi River with the exception of Texas." Please, before the 1980 election, check the map for the location of the state of Missouri. Charlie Baum '77
